Keeping a Grip: The Hex Socket and Bit Retention

The adapter features a 1/4-inch hex shank input and output, making it universally compatible with standard screwdriver bits and power drill chucks. This standardized interface is a critical design element, ensuring seamless integration into any existing toolkit. It just fits.

Crucially, the output socket is described as magnetic, a small but significant detail for practical use. A magnetic bit holder prevents bits from falling out during operation, especially when working overhead or in confined spaces where retrieving a dropped bit is a major hassle. This secure retention means fewer interruptions and less frustration, directly impacting efficiency.

This magnetic retention system ensures that the bit stays firmly seated, allowing the user to apply consistent pressure and torque without worrying about cam-out or the bit slipping. When dealing with a stubborn, rusted bolt, maintaining a solid connection is paramount to avoid rounding off the fastener head. This feature directly aids in preserving fastener integrity.
